Impact of Pinterest on Purchase Decisions. Forbes reports that women trust recommendations from Pinterest more than recommendations from any other social network platform (https://www.forbes.com/sites/marketshare/2012/03/20/why-brand-managers-need-to-take-an-interest-in -pinterest/#5e3b22fb6375). But does trust in Pinterest differ by gender? The following sample data show the number of women and men who stated in a recent sample that they trust recommendations made on Pinterest.

Chapter 10.4, Problem 31E, Impact of Pinterest on Purchase Decisions. Forbes reports that women trust recommendations from

  1. a. What is the point estimate of the proportion of women who trust recommendations made on Pinterest?
  2. b. What is the point estimate of the proportion of men who trust recommendations made on Pinterest?
  3. c. Provide a 95% confidence interval estimate of the difference between the proportion of women and men who trust recommendations made on Pinterest.

Question 1 The data shown in Table 1 are and R values for 24 samples of size n = 5 taken from a process producing bearings. The measurements are made on the inside diameter of the bearing, with only the last three decimals recorded (i.e., 34.5 should be 0.50345). Table 1: Bearing Diameter Data Sample Number I R Sample Number I R 1 34.5 3 13 35.4 8 2 34.2 4 14 34.0 6 3 31.6 4 15 37.1 5 4 31.5 4 16 34.9 7 5 35.0 5 17 33.5 4 6 34.1 6 18 31.7 3 7 32.6 4 19 34.0 8 8 33.8 3 20 35.1 9 34.8 7 21 33.7 2 10 33.6 8 22 32.8 1 11 31.9 3 23 33.5 3 12 38.6 9 24 34.2 2 (a) Set up and R charts on this process. Does the process seem to be in statistical control? If necessary, revise the trial control limits. [15 pts] (b) If specifications on this diameter are 0.5030±0.0010, find the percentage of nonconforming bearings pro- duced by this process. Assume that diameter is normally distributed. [10 pts] 1
